Edward M. Reingold is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Computational Theory and Mathematics and Computer Networks and Communications. According to data from OpenAlex, Edward M. Reingold has authored 76 papers receiving a total of 6.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 24 papers in Computational Theory and Mathematics and 19 papers in Computer Networks and Communications. Recurrent topics in Edward M. Reingold's work include Algorithms and Data Compression (19 papers), Optimization and Search Problems (10 papers) and graph theory and CDMA systems (9 papers). Edward M. Reingold is often cited by papers focused on Algorithms and Data Compression (19 papers), Optimization and Search Problems (10 papers) and graph theory and CDMA systems (9 papers). Edward M. Reingold collaborates with scholars based in United States, France and Israel. Edward M. Reingold's co-authors include Narsingh Deo, Jürg Nievergelt, J. Bitner, J. Nievergelt, Tony Greenfield, Kenneth J. Supowit, Gideon Ehrlich, Laurent Alonso, Nachum Dershowitz and Robert E. Tarjan and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Information Theory, Communications of the ACM and Mathematics of Computation.
